Senior Technical Program Manager, Data Center - Engineering Operations
About the role
The Senior Technical Program Manager (TPM) will lead coordination, planning, and execution activities for our Datacenter Server product deployments in internal development data centers. They will develop and lead end-to-end project plans to improve infrastructure stability, observability, and uptime; help define and drive KPIs. They will provide hands-on program management during analysis, design, development, testing, implementation, and post implementation phases. They will interact with diverse technical groups, spanning all organizational levels.

Pay
Your base salary will be determined based on your location, experience, and the pay of employees in similar positions. The base salary range is 168,000 USD - 258,750 USD for Level 4, and 200,000 USD - 322,000 USD for Level 5.
